Piping systems have undergone significant transformations over the past few decades. As infrastructure demands increase, so does the need for piping solutions that are not only robust but also adaptable and easy to maintain. Traditional welding methods, while reliable, often fall short in terms of flexibility and installation speed.
Mechanical joining techniques have gained traction due to their ability to expedite installation without compromising on safety or durability. The Victaulic Cut Groove system epitomizes this shift, offering a mechanical coupling method that simplifies assembly and maintenance.
Victaulic Cut Groove technology involves creating a groove near the end of a steel pipe, which allows for a mechanical coupling to be fitted securely. This method contrasts with traditional grooving techniques by providing a cleaner cut and maintaining the integrity of the pipe wall.
One of the primary advantages of the Victaulic Cut Groove system is the reduction in installation time. By eliminating the need for welding, projects can progress more rapidly. Additionally, this method reduces the potential for heat-related pipe damages and the associated safety risks.
Time is a critical factor in construction and maintenance projects. The Victaulic Cut Groove steel pipe system allows for a significant decrease in installation time compared to welded systems.
With simplified assembly processes, less skilled labor is required, leading to cost savings. The ease of installation also minimizes downtime in maintenance scenarios.
Eliminating welding from the installation process reduces the hazards associated with hot works. This contributes to a safer working environment and complies with strict safety regulations.

Comparing Victaulic Cut Groove steel pipes to other piping solutions highlights their superiority in key areas.
While welding provides a strong bond, it lacks the flexibility and ease of installation offered by the Victaulic system. Mechanical joints also allow for movement and vibration absorption.
Flanged connections require precise alignment and are time-consuming to install. Victaulic couplings are more forgiving and quicker to assemble.
Despite the advantages, certain considerations must be taken into account when implementing Victaulic Cut Groove steel pipes.
The upfront cost of mechanical couplings can be higher than traditional methods. However, the long-term savings often offset this initial expenditure.
Proper grooving of pipes requires specific tools. Investing in or renting this equipment is necessary for accurate installation.
